I can't imagine you'd run into any problems (other than the completely random chance of a cranky customs agent which can happen anywhere).
Most of the border crossings between the US and Canada on the East Coast are relatively mellow. Just have the address for where you'll be staying handy for the forms.
And make sure your rental car's insurance is good in the U.S. and you can take the car out of Canada.
